There are many reasons why Algebra matters in life. One reason that comes to mind is from an early age, your understanding and success in algebra can help build math confidence, notable achievements in high school coursework and college readiness, and more importantly help predict one’s salary earnings on so many levels. As one would know that nearly all sports statistics are produced using algebraic equations. Average points per game are used to determine the Most Valuable Player. Winning percentages are used to determine top rankings. These are calculated with concepts learned in Algebra. Formulas are a part of our lives, whether we drive a car and need to calculate the distance, or need to work out our food volume intake for dieting; algebraic formulas are used every day without us even realizing it.

The history of Algebra began in ancient Egypt and Babylon, where people learned to solve linear and quadratic equations which the equations had many unknown variables, (Khan, 2015). In exploring the origin of Algebra, we first look at the word which is a Latin modified word from the Arabic word al-jabr.
